#63dd83 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#63dd83 is composed of 38.8% red, 86.7%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.7%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 135.7 degrees, a saturation of 64.2% and a lightness of 62.7%. #63dd83 color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ffff with #00bb07.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#63dd83
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010502 is the darkest color, while #f4fdf6 is the lightest one.
